Cobtree Estate Update

Meeting: 20/01/2020 - Cobtree Manor Estate Charity Committee (Item 61)

Minutes:

The Leisure Manager presented his report providing an update on activities at the Cobtree Manor Estate during the period November 2019 to January 2020.  The report included details of:

 

·  Maintenance works, staffing issues, including the appointment of Nigel Holman as the new Cobtree Officer with effect from 1 February 2020, visitor numbers and the progress on the preparation of a new management plan and Green Flag submission for the Manor Park.

 

·  The progress being made by MyTime Active with regard to the Golf Course development works.

 

·  The success of Kent Life in winning the silver award in the best large attraction category at the Visit Kent awards and in winning the silver award in Tourism South East’s Awards for Excellence for the best Tourism Festival/Experience.

 

·  The position with regard to the completion of the lease and management agreement to the Cobtree Young Farmers’ Club to enable it to secure funding through a Heritage Lottery funded project and commence conservation grazing on part of Forstal Field.

 

·  The progress of the discussions with Planning Solutions, the operators of Kent Life, regarding the proposed Cobtree Railway project.

 

During the discussion on this item:

 

The Leisure Manager undertook to circulate the new management plan for the Manor Park and an update on the Golf Course works to Members of the Committee for information.

 

Concern was expressed about the time being taken to finalise the lease and management agreement to the Cobtree Young Farmers’ Club.  Members were mindful of the need for the documentation to be completed before 1 March 2020 to enable the Club to secure funding.  It was suggested and agreed that the Corporate Property Manager be given delegated authority to put in place an arrangement to enable the Club to occupy land at Forstal Field until such time that the lease and management agreement are finalised, and that an update be provided for Members of the Committee by the end of the month.

 

It was also suggested and agreed that Members of the Committee should meet with representatives of the Cobtree Charity Trust Limited and the operators of Kent Life to discuss the proposed Cobtree Railway project and, in particular, the funding and operational arrangements.

 

RESOLVED:

 

1.  That the update on activities at the Cobtree Manor Estate during the period November 2019 to January 2020 be noted.

 

2.  That the Corporate Property Manager be given delegated authority to put in place an arrangement to enable the Cobtree Young Farmers’ Club to occupy land at Forstal Field until such time that the lease and management agreement are finalised, and that an update be provided for Members of the Committee by the end of the month.

 

3.  That Members of the Committee should meet with representatives of the Cobtree Charity Trust Limited and the operators of Kent Life to discuss the proposed Cobtree Railway project and, in particular, the funding and operational arrangements.
